Maximizing Space and Loading Strategically

An often-overlooked part of the service is how to fill the dumpster strategically. A disorganized load can lead to inefficiency and the need for a second container.

By being intentional of how you load your dumpster, you ensure that you're using the container to its best capacity. We encourage customers to disassemble large items when possible and arrange debris to eliminate empty gaps. Think of it like packing a moving truck—the tighter and more strategic you load, the more you can fit without wasted air space.

Keeping the Area Safe and Accessible

Once your dumpster is placed, maintaining a secure and accessible area around it is crucial. Avoid placing items next to or on top of the container, and check nothing hinders the path to it.

We also recommend limiting access to the area for safety. Open dumpsters can present hazards if not handled properly. Having a clear zone not only makes loading easier but also reduces the likelihood of accidents or damage to property.
